Knowing the Austin, TX Climate

Austin, TX has a humid subtropical climate with hot summers and mild winters. The average annual temperature is around 68∞F, with July being the warmest month and January the coolest. Understanding these climatic conditions is crucial in selecting the right plants for your commercial properties.

Factors to Consider when Selecting Bursera Bonsai

Sunlight: Bursera bonsai thrive in full sun to partial shade. Consider the specific sun exposure at each property to determine the best placement for the bonsai.

Watering: Austin’s hot summers require plants that can withstand dry conditions. Choose bursera bonsai that are drought-tolerant to minimize maintenance efforts.

Temperature Tolerance: Given the fluctuating temperatures in Austin, select bursera bonsai that can withstand both heat and mild cold spells.

Soil Type: Ensure the bonsai’s soil requirements align with the soil type prevalent in the commercial properties to promote healthy growth.

Mature Size: Consider the available space at each property to select bursera bonsai that will not outgrow their designated area.
